Understanding the 2024 MLB Postseason Format

Before we jump into the Dodgers' specific schedule, it's essential to understand how the MLB postseason works these days. The format has evolved over the years, and knowing the basics will help you follow the team's journey. Now, guys, the postseason typically begins with the Wild Card Series, where the lower seeds in each league (National League and American League) face off in a best-of-three series. The winners of these series then advance to the Division Series. The Division Series features the winners of the Wild Card Series plus the division winners with the best regular-season records. This is where things get really exciting, as the teams battle it out in a best-of-five series. The victors then progress to the League Championship Series (LCS). The LCS sees the remaining teams from each league go head-to-head in a best-of-seven series, a true test of skill and endurance. Finally, the winners of the LCS from both leagues clash in the World Series, the ultimate showdown for the Commissioner's Trophy, played in a best-of-seven format. Keep in mind that the exact dates and times can fluctuate based on game outcomes and television scheduling, but this gives you a general overview of the roadmap to the World Series.

The Importance of Seeding and Home-Field Advantage

Seeding plays a massive role in the postseason. The higher the seed, the more advantages a team gets. For example, a higher seed earns home-field advantage in the earlier rounds, meaning they get to host more games. Home-field advantage can be a significant boost, as it gives the team familiar surroundings and the energy of their home crowd. Another advantage of a higher seed is potentially avoiding a Wild Card Series, allowing them to rest their key players and strategize. This can be crucial, given the intensity and fatigue of the postseason. In short, every game, every win during the regular season, can significantly impact a team's postseason path. How to Watch the Dodgers in the Playoffs

So, you’ve got your schedule, but now you need to know where to watch the Dodgers in action. Thankfully, there are plenty of ways to catch every game. Here’s a breakdown of your viewing options.

TV Channels

The majority of postseason games will be broadcast on national television channels. These are your go-to sources.

  • ESPN: ESPN often carries Wild Card and Division Series games.
  • TBS: TBS is frequently the home of the Division Series and League Championship Series.
  • Fox/FS1: Fox and FS1 usually broadcast some Division Series and League Championship Series games, and Fox is the exclusive broadcaster of the World Series.

Make sure you have access to these channels through your cable or satellite provider.

Streaming Services

If you've cut the cord, or prefer to stream, don’t worry! There are options.

  • ESPN+: ESPN+ sometimes offers live streams of certain playoff games, though this is less common for the main series.
  • Hulu + Live TV: This service includes access to ESPN, TBS, and FS1, providing a comprehensive viewing experience.
  • Sling TV: Sling TV provides access to channels like ESPN, TBS, and FS1. The packages can be customized.
  • YouTube TV: YouTube TV offers a similar channel lineup, including all the major playoff networks.

Always check your streaming service's listings to confirm which games they will be showing.

Radio

For those who prefer to listen on the go or just enjoy the classic feel of radio, you can tune into the Dodgers' radio broadcasts. In Los Angeles, you can typically find the games on AM 570 LA Sports or listen to the Spanish broadcast on KTNQ 1020 AM. Remember that radio broadcasts can also be an excellent option if you are traveling or are unable to watch on TV.
